Staff members can easily view and manage all loan applications in Narmi Command.
View Loan Applications
If you have Narmi Lend enabled, your Applications menu in Narmi Command has two options: Deposits (for account opening) and Loans (for lending).
Select Loans to view loan applications. The tabs that appear depend on the loan types your institution has enabled: Personal (for personal loans) and Credit cards (for credit card loans).
The following columns are available depending on the tab selected:
Applicant – The applicant's full name
Last Updated – The date and time that the application was last updated
Evaluation – The link to the full identity evaluation decision in the Alloy platform
Status – The status of the application; go to Loan Application Statuses for details
Loan Amount (Personal loans only) – The total amount of the loan amount requested
Card Product (Credit card loans only) – The name of the credit card product selected

Sort Applications
By default, applications are sorted by Last Updated date, newest to oldest. To sort by Applicant or Loan Amount, select the arrows next to those headers. 
Search Applications
You can search for a specific application by entering an applicant name, email, Social Security Number, or application UUID in the search box.

Filter Applications
Filter the applications list by selecting the filter icon in the search box.

A side panel appears with the following filter options:
Applicant details – Enter a specific applicant name, email, or SSN
Status – The application status; go to Loan Application Statuses for details
Source – The flow used to complete the application, either:
Banking – The flow from the Narmi Banking application
Online – The flow from your institution’s website
Last updated – Enter a date range for when the application was last updated
Requested loan amount – Enter a dollar amount range

Application Details
Select an applicant’s row to open a side panel with the following loan details:
Application details – Details about the application, including:
Date created – The timestamp at which the application was initially created in Narmi Lend. The application is created after the applicant submits their personal information.
Last updated – The date and time when the application was last updated. This could be when the application was submitted or when your staff adds notes to the application.
Application ID – A unique ID link for the application. Please always reference this ID when submitting a support ticket to Narmi.
Application number – Used for internal Narmi tracking
Source – Specifies the flow where the application was completed, either “Institution site” or "Online banking”
Loan type – Personal loan or Credit card
Application record – A downloadable PDF of the application. This is only available for applications with “Offer accepted” status.

Decisioning evaluation – Select View details to see the full identity evaluation decision in the Alloy platform. This is only available if the applicant has reached this stage of the application.

Applicant details – Details about the applicant, including:
Name
Phone number – This field does not display if no value is present
Email
Date of birth
Social security number/ITIN – SSN or Individual Taxpayer Identification Number (ITIN). Select the eye icon to reveal the number, select again to hide the number
Physical address

Loan offers/Card offer – For personal loans, this lists the loans that the applicant was pre-qualified for. If a loan was selected, it has a checkmark next to it. For credit card loans, the selected card offer is shown.

Application history – A history timeline showing the application's lifecycle. This section shows:
Application lifecycle steps in user-friendly language, such as "Application created” or “Offer accepted."
Source of the application (the flow where it was completed), either "institution site" or "online banking.”

Notes – Your staff can use this open input text box to enter any internal notes about the application. Adding notes will update the application’s “Last updated” date shown in Application details section.

Loan Application Statuses
Loan applications may have the following statuses:
Creating – The applicant is in the process of completing the application.
Decisioning Processing – Data is in the process of being submitted to Alloy for decisioning.
Expired – The application expired because the applicant started a new application before completing their last one.
Failed – The Alloy decisioning process failed for an unknown reason.
Offers generated – The applicant was presented with loan offerings.
Offer accepted – The applicant selected the offer and submitted the application.
Pending – Data has been submitted to Alloy and is awaiting a decision.
Rejected – The Alloy decisioning process rejected the applicant.
